What gets built in Temple Terrace. Temple Terrace is a built-up suburban city in Hillsborough County, just northeast of Tampa near the University of South Florida. Its commercial development is dominated by retail and neighborhood shopping centers, multifamily and student-housing apartments, medical office, and the mixed-use redevelopment moving through the Fowler Avenue, 56th Street, and Temple Terrace Highway corridors. The USF-adjacent submarket keeps a steady pipeline of apartment, retail, and institutional construction.

Wind and code. Temple Terrace is outside Florida's High-Velocity Hurricane Zone but remains in a hurricane wind region. Hillsborough County commercial glazing is designed to the Florida Building Code under ASCE 7, typically Exposure B or C with ultimate design wind speeds around 150 mph for Risk Category II buildings, and documented through Florida Product Approval. ACG keeps approval documentation current and ties install instructions to the specific approval for each opening, which matters on multifamily where the unit count multiplies every detail.
